欢迎光临
我们一直在努力
共 15 篇文章

标签:batis

Mybatis之插件原理

鲁春利的工作笔记,好记性不如烂笔头 转载自:深入浅出Mybatis-插件原理 Mybatis采用责任链模式,通过动态代理组织多个拦截器(插件),通过这些拦截器可以改变Mybatis的默认行为(诸如SQL重写之类的),由于插件会深入到Myba...

云搜网云搜网聚合分类

MyBatis基础入门

鲁春利的工作笔记,好记性不如烂笔头 官方文档详见:http://www.mybatis.org/mybatis-3/zh/index.html 入门 XML配置 XML映射文件 动态SQL Java API 日志

云搜网云搜网聚合分类

MyBatis-Plus 自定义sql语句

  一、引言   MP自带的条件构造器虽然很强大,有时候也避免不了写稍微复杂一点业务的sql,那么那么今天说说MP怎么自定义sql语句吧。   二、配置   自定义的sql当然是写在XML文件中的啦,那么首先来定义xml文件的位置,在yml...

云搜网云搜网聚合分类

mybatis介绍与环境搭建

一、不用纯jdbc的原因,即缺点。 1、数据库理解,使用时创建,不用时释放,会对数据库进行频繁的链接开启和关闭,造成数据库的资源浪费,影响数据库的性能。设想:使用数据库的连接池。2、将sql语句硬编码到java代码中,不利于系统维护。设想:...

云搜网云搜网聚合分类

mybatis 基础理解

1、主要的类 1.1 SqlSessionFactoryBuilder      用于创建SqlSessionFactory,要通过配置文件也可以是代码。    主要的方法 SqlSessi...

云搜网云搜网聚合分类

Mybatis缓存详解

 什么是Mybatis缓存?   使用缓存可以减少Java Application与数据库的交互次数,从而提升程序的运行效率。比如,查询id=1的user对象,第一次查询出来之后,会自动将该对象保存到缓存中。下一次查询该对象时,就可以直接从...

云搜网云搜网聚合分类

SpringMVC + MyBatis整合 【转】

环境:spring3.1.1+mybatis3.2.8+mybatis-spring1.2.3 网络上关于这个架构的搭建文章,实在是太多了,本文是对于本人初次搭建时的一些注意点的整理。 主要是一些配置文件的内容和架构的目录。 0. proj...

云搜网云搜网聚合分类

mybatis的一对多映射

    延续mybatis的一对一问题,还是上面一对一举得那个例子(http://fengcl.blog.51cto.com/9961331/1875657), 如果一个用户有多个作品怎么办?这就涉及...

云搜网云搜网聚合分类

MyBatis之简单了解Plugin

MyBatis的Configuration配置中有一个Plugin配置,根据其名可以解释为“插件”,这个插件实质可以理解为“拦截器”。“拦截器”这个名词不陌生,在众多框架中均有“拦截器”。这个Plugin有什么用呢?活着说拦截器有什么用呢?...

云搜网云搜网聚合分类

mybatis中${}和#{}的区别

在mybatis中的编写xml文件时 我们经常遇到参数的传入 总结一下${}和#{}的区别:   1.#{} 有效的防止sql注入    #{} 直接传入的是你参数值 不会加上”” 2....

云搜网云搜网聚合分类

MyBatis-Plus 自定义sql语句 - MySQL数据库

  一、引言   MP自带的条件构造器虽然很强大,有时候也避免不了写稍微复杂一点业务的sql,那么那么今天说说MP怎么自定义sql语句吧。   二、配置   自定义的sql当然是写在XML文件中的啦,那么首先来定义xml文件的位置,在yml...

云搜网云搜网聚合分类